From f06d877d131e098145d5584286c385eb7d1fdd5c Mon Sep 17 00:00:00 2001 From: Jon Gjengset Date: Sun, 3 May 2020 13:17:19 -0400 Subject: [PATCH] Relax racy fairness test Fixes #477 --- crossbeam-channel/tests/ready.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/crossbeam-channel/tests/ready.rs b/crossbeam-channel/tests/ready.rs index 23769b7bd..340379413 100644 --- a/crossbeam-channel/tests/ready.rs +++ b/crossbeam-channel/tests/ready.rs @@ -772,7 +772,7 @@ fn fairness1() { #[test] fn fairness2() { - const COUNT: usize = 10_000; + const COUNT: usize = 100_000; let (s1, r1) = unbounded::<()>(); let (s2, r2) = bounded::<()>(1); @@ -831,7 +831,7 @@ fn fairness2() { } } } - assert!(hits.iter().all(|x| x.get() >= COUNT / hits.len() / 10)); + assert!(hits.iter().all(|x| x.get() > 0)); }) .unwrap(); }